Looking for a pair of mud tyres, ideally i'd go two sets, both wet screams and swampys for different conditions, but money restricts me to one set.
Never tried either so need some input.
From what i understand -
Swampys - For wet gluey weather, not for the torrential rain, but for the aftermath. Turns nicely, grips nicely on wet roots and rocks.
Wet Screams - For when it's hammering down, there's lots of surface water, for when you need something to cut through the filth. But doesn't turn too well and not so good on roots and rocks.
Are these correct assumptions.
Is the grip difference in the wet night and day?
I tend to find more grip than the majority, finding high rollers (42a f, 60a rear) just enough for the wet days at the moment, just losing it in the worst current gloop.
I want the tyres to make the rest of winter somewhat comfortably ridable.
